1871 KU KLUX KLAN. President Ulysses S. Grant Exposes Outrages Committed by the KKK. Rare! George Whitefield We shall be glad toAn exceptionally rare Congressional issue of President Ulysses S. Grant's speech, and associated testimony and research, detailing in lurid detail the atrocities committed by the Ku Klux Klan in the aftermath of the Emancipation Proclamation and the end of the Civil War. One of the most significant Klan documents of the era. No examples in the trade and not traced at auction. From the superb Slavery and Southern Collection of Rev. Milton S. Carothers,
